Celery prefers moist soil and its rather shallow, concentrated root system must be considered by applying frequent, light irrigation.

WebCelery plants grow best with full sun, plenty of water, and soil rich in organic matter. Add several inches of organic compost to your garden bed a week or two before transplanting. Web27 feb. 2024 · Sorrel ( Rumex acetosa) Sorrel is a leafy perennial green with a citrusy, tangy taste when cooked. Sorrel leaves grow to about 24” (60 cm) high, and when eaten raw, have a sour taste. The leafy greens go well in salads, soups, sauces, and stews.
